Atiku’s Petition Dismissed In It’s Entirety – Lead Judgement

    Posted by on September 11, 2019,



The PEPC has dismissed the petition by Atiku Abubakar and the PDP callenging the election of President Muhammadu Buhari of APC.

The court held that the petitiioners failed to prove their case. The judgement by the five-member tribunal was read by Garba Mohammed.

The tribunal ruled each of the five arguments by the PDP and Mr Abubakar against them Mohammed said the petitioners failed to prove their petition beyond reasonable doubt and the petition “is hereby dismissed in its entirety.”

As part of its ruling, the tribunal said Mr Abubakar and the PDP provided no evidence that the 2019 general election was not in compliance with the Electoral Act.

Mr Mohammed noted a number of allegations brought by the petitioners to back their claim of massive non-compliance to electoral guidelines across the nation.

There is no admissible evidence on record to support the petitioner’s allegations, the court ruled.
